THOUSANDS WANT | FAT JOBS OFFERED | IN ARBUCKLE "AD" Philanthropist Deluged With, Letters and Girls Begin _ Work of Sifting Them. WOMEN AREN’T BARRED. Sugar Magnate Desires Relief to Devote Time to His Home for Cripples. A @oore of young women clerks em- ployed by the Arbuckle Brothers of No. 71 Water a yt, sugar refiners, will to- morrow begin to open the thousands of letters that have been received in re- sponse to an advertisement pia the newspapers by: John Arbucki three assistants, Ho offers to pay them | $10,000, $5,000 and $2,500 a year each. Of course ail the applicants are expected to be experienced in the busi- | ness; no novices will be accepted. “The only way [ shall have of alft- ing out the worthy applicants will be by the general tone of their letters. | Ther general history and expertence will determine my attitude. It will no doubt be a difficult task to select the right persons for the Jobs. “I want more time to devote to the erection of the home for cripples that 1 am planning for New Paltz, N. Y. I have advertised in the papers asking answers from «1 cripples who are anxtous to earn their living. It is for them that I am to build this new home. From the number of answers that I receive I will be able to determine how 1 the home will have to be. It won't, of course, be more than one story high, to protect the inmates against fire.
